    Pride Health is Hiring – Entry-Level Phlebotomist / PSR I

    \n

    Location: Clermont, FL 34711

    \n

    Schedule: Tuesday – Friday | 6:30 AM – 3:30 PM

    \n

    Days Off: Sunday & Monday

    \n

    Time Zone: Eastern

    \n

    Pride Health is currently hiring an Entry-Level PSR I / Lobby Experience Coordinator to support our healthcare client in Clermont, FL.

    \n

    Job Responsibilities:

    \n
    • \n
    • Greet patients upon arrival and provide a welcoming experience
    • \n
    • Assist patients with check-in using a self-service kiosk or handheld tablet
    • \n
    • Answer patient questions and explain procedures with care and compassion
    • \n
    • Maintain a clean, safe, and professional lobby environment
    • \n
    • Support phlebotomists during breaks and staffing shortages
    • \n
    • Perform phlebotomy and specimen collection duties as needed
    • \n
    • Maintain accurate records and patient documentation
    • \n
    • Follow established safety, confidentiality, and specimen-handling procedures
    • \n
    • Provide a high level of customer service while maintaining patient confidentiality
    • \n
    \n

    Requirements:

    \n
    • \n
    • High School Diploma or equivalent required
    • \n
    • Some phlebotomy experience required; internship/externship experience is acceptable
    • \n
    • 1–2 years of client-facing/customer service experience required
    • \n
    • Strong customer service and communication skills
    • \n
    • Keyboard/data entry experience required
    • \n
    • Comfortable working directly with patients
    • \n
    • Reliable transportation is required
    • \n
    • Must be able to work the assigned schedule consistently and arrive on time
